one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method over the internet in which an extended URL is often converted into a shorter, far more manageable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the first extensive URL when frequented. Providers like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social networking platforms like Twitter, where character boundaries for posts manufactured it difficult to share long URLs.

Beyond social networking, URL shorteners are beneficial in promoting campaigns, e-mails, and printed media where by long URLs could be cumbersome.

two. Main Parts of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ily includes the subsequent factors:

World wide web Interface: Here is the front-close portion where by customers can enter their prolonged URLs and receive shortened variations. It may be an easy type on the Website.
Database: A database is critical to retail store the mapping in between the original lengthy URL along with the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L alternatives like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that will take the small URL and redirects the person on the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is often executed in the internet server or an application lay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ners present an API to make sure that third-celebration appl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ial prolonged URLs.
3. Creating the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a short 1. Quite a few methods is often employed, for example:

Hashing: The extended URL may be hashed into a hard and fast-measurement string, which serves given that the short UR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(distinctive URLs leading to a similar h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 prevalent approach is to implement Base62 encoding (which makes use of s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, plus a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ds into the entry in the database. This process makes sure that the shorter URL is as short as you can.
Random String Era: A further solution would be to produce a random string of a set size (e.g., 6 characters) and Examine if it’s previously in use during the database. If not, it’s assigned to the lengthy URL.
four. Databases Management
The databases schema for the URL shortener is normally simple, with two Key fields:

ID: A unique identifier for each URL entry.
Extensive URL: The original URL that needs to be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The brief Edition of the URL, generally saved as a unique string.
Besides these, you may want to keep metadata including the generation date, expiration day, and the volume of situations the small URL continues to be accessed.

5.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is often a significant A part of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a person clicks on a brief URL, the service must swiftly retrieve the initial URL from your database and redirect the consumer employing an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) status code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ure ought to be just about inst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) could be utilized to hurry up the retrieval procedure.

six. Stability Concerns
Protection is an important conc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to distribute malicious backl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party security companies to examine UR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can avert abuse by spammers seeking to deliver thousands of brief UR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ic throughout a number of servers to deal with higher lo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se companies to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often deliver analytics to track how often a brief URL is clicked, exactly where the visitors is coming from, and other practical met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
